Glass Houghton Rock

Computer Code: GH Preferred Map Code: notEntered
Status Code: Index Level
Age range: Bolsovian Substage (CC) — Bolsovian Substage (CC)
Lithological Description: Brown and grey micaceous sandstone.
Definition of Lower Boundary: none recorded or not applicable
Definition of Upper Boundary: none recorded or not applicable
Thickness: 30m in Glass Houghton area; known to 42m in borehole cores.
Geographical Limits: West/south Yorkshire, especially between Castleford and Sharlston [Glass Houghton, near Castleford, Yorkshire].
Parent Unit: Pennine Middle Coal Measures Formation (PMCM)
Previous Name(s): Houghton Rock [Obsolete Name and Code: Use GH] (-2823)
